Three Bean Chili

A satisfying, congition-conscious dinner packed with soluble fiber to support digestive wellness and lean complete proteins for targeted muscle recovery. Easy hot meal at the end of the day, or a fast meal prep for weekly lunches. Don't forget toast!

Ingredients:

  • 6 oz lean ground turkey

  • 1 can kidney beans, drained and rinsed

  • 1 can black beans, drained and rinsed

  • 1 can pinto beans, drained and rinsed

  • 1/2 cup butternut squash, peeled and cubed

  • 1 cup crushed low-sodium tomatoes

  • 1/2 large onion, diced

  • 1/2 cup corn

  • 1/2 cup celery, chopped

  • 1 green bell pepper, chopped

  • 2 cloves garlic, minced ( I admit I cheat and use a bunch of garlic powder instead)

  • 1 tbsp chili powder

  • 1 tsp ground cumin


Instructions:

  1. In a large soup pot, cook the ground turkey over medium-high heat until fully browned, draining any excess grease.

  2. Reduce the heat to medium and stir in the diced onion, chopped green bell pepper, and minced garlic, sautéing for 3 minutes.

  3. Add the rinsed kidney, black, and pinto beans, followed by the cubed butternut squash and crushed low-sodium tomatoes.

  4. Season with the chili powder and ground cumin, then cover and simmer on low-medium heat for 30 minutes until squash is tender before serving.


This total recipe is about 2160 calories, 200 grams of protein, and 55 grams of fiber.

If you divide this into 4 servings then each bowl is about 540 calories, 50 grams of protein, and 14 grams of fiber.
